Why the hepatitis a, b & c test panel may be ordered for Hepatitis

This blood test is used to detect whether or not an individual has Hepatitis A, B and/or C by testing for their corresponding antibodies and antigens.

When evaluating Hepatitis, a healthcare provider may order the hepatitis a, b & c test panel alongside other tests based on your symptoms, history, and physical exam. Test selection and result interpretation are clinical decisions made by a qualified professional.
